我想读写一些特殊格式的保存文件。然而,我目前的能力范围是编译go源代码,然后用Python调用它并返回JSON。
GO之间有没有更好的沟通方式!那Python呢?
发布于 2012-09-11 13:10:14
Go有一种用于序列化数据的gob
格式,但是golang-nuts上的一些mailing list discussion表明,在与其他语言通信时,它不是一个好的选择。
JSON将是一个非常受人尊敬的选择,或者您可以尝试使用protobufs,这也是我在上面链接的讨论中建议的。
编辑:您也可以根据自己的需要尝试与Thrift通信,但对于您正在做的事情来说,这可能不太可能。
发布于 2012-09-15 00:40:37
还有BSON,您可以将其视为JSON的二进制版本,它实现了许多语言,包括Go和Python语言。
https://stackoverflow.com/questions/12362615
复制相似问题